Output 5de8800f7aed826638ebbeeed865cad64740431ee38e364dcb768794b2b32c57:5

value
73830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55fd8bb500cab6a263305317573de811d1d7c686 OP_EQUAL
address
39Xh6WrYhJED74HnWdc7fPAHxTczKQw6SS
transaction
5de8800f7aed826638ebbeeed865cad64740431ee38e364dcb768794b2b32c57
confirmations
444617
spent
true